Stable Coalition
A consistent and long-lasting alliance between individuals or groups aimed at achieving common goals.
Structural Therapy
A form of family therapy that focuses on reorganizing family systems and boundaries to promote healthier interactions and relationships within the family.
Psychopathology
The scientific study of mental disorders, including their symptoms, etiology (causes), and treatment.
Communication Systems Therapy
A therapeutic approach focusing on the patterns and systems of communication within relational or family systems to address and resolve issues.
